BTCS Joins Russell Microcap Index as Ether Treasury Firms Continue to Post Big Gains
Nasdaq-listed Blockchain Technology Consensus Solutions (BTCS) is set to join the Russell Microcap Index, amplifying its visibility among investors tracking small-cap U.S. companies. The Maryland-based firm, which focuses on Ethereum-centric operations like staking and block building, recently unveiled a $100 million plan to bolster its ETH holdings. Its proprietary analytics platform, ChainQ, aims to streamline blockchain data analysis for users.
Index inclusion could spur demand from institutional investors and mutual funds that benchmark against Russell indexes. BTCS shares surged 22% in pre-market trading, extending a 100% monthly gain. The MOVE mirrors a broader trend of companies leveraging ether treasury strategies to drive shareholder value. GameSquare (GAME) shares jumped 45% pre-market after announcing a $100 million ETH reserve plan, while SharpLink Gaming (SBET)—now the largest corporate ETH holder—rose 16%.
Midas Expands Tokenized Yield Infrastructure with Etherlink Integration
Midas is leveraging Etherlink's sub-500ms finality to redefine institutional access to structured yield products. The platform's latest offerings—mMEV and mRe7YIELD—aim to eliminate intermediaries while maintaining compliance and custody control. Built on Tezos' high-speed LAYER 2 solution, Etherlink provides near-instant settlement with decentralized sequencing, addressing critical pain points in institutional DeFi.
The move follows successful deployments of mBASIS and mTBILL, which have already secured $11 million in total value locked. Etherlink's architecture combines the speed of Ethereum rollups with robust security guarantees, enabling complex strategies like arbitrage and portfolio rebalancing to execute with unprecedented efficiency.
Ethereum Derivatives Market Shows Signs of Speculative Overheating as Open Interest Hits Record $24.5 Billion
Ethereum's derivatives market is flashing warning signs as open interest surges to an all-time high of $24.5 billion. The 37% monthly increase coincides with ETH's 24% price rally, pushing leverage ratios and funding rates to levels last seen during the 2022 bull market.
Perpetual futures funding rates have reached historically elevated levels, while the estimated leverage ratio approaches previous cycle peaks. This derivatives frenzy reflects traders' aggressive bets on continued upside—but creates vulnerability to cascading liquidations should momentum stall.
The past week alone saw $2.9 billion in new positions as ETH climbed from $2,600 to $3,160. Market observers note the parallel between current derivatives activity and previous market tops, where excessive leverage preceded sharp corrections.

RISC Zero Launches Boundless Testnet on Base to Enable Verifiable Compute Across Chains
RISC Zero's incentivized testnet for its Boundless network went live on Coinbase's Base layer-2 yesterday. The platform operates as a decentralized marketplace for zero-knowledge proofs, allowing any blockchain to offload complex computations without architectural overhauls.
Boundless connects proof requesters with hardware operators who stake ZKC tokens to guarantee honest work. The system settles compact cryptographic receipts on host chains, minimizing gas costs while maintaining mathematical certainty. This mirrors Chainlink's role in oracle services but for verifiable computation.
The launch signals growing demand for modular ZK infrastructure as Ethereum's ecosystem matures. By abstracting proof generation from settlement layers, Boundless could accelerate adoption of zero-knowledge technology across DeFi and Web3 applications.
